Great Closed-back Headphones at a Fantastic Price!

Get clear, full-range personal monitoring for a great price with a pair of Samson's SR850 closed-back studio headphones. These inexpensive headphones offer many of the same feature found on models costing three times as much. SR950s give you solid bass and clear highs with a huge frequency response. The closed-back design provides noise reduction and sound isolation. Sweetwater knows that sound isolation while recording is important for any project, and we're confident that the SR950s can do the job. Whether you're looking for an affordable pair of headphones for your studio, or simply want to experience the finer details of your favorite music, you're going enjoy listening with a pair of Samson SR950s.

Samson SR950 Closed-back Studio Headphones Features at a Glance:
  • Oversized 50mm drivers deliver extraordinary depth and low-end resolution
  • Closed-back design prevents overwhelming bass, allowing you to hear fine details of your tracks
  • Self-adjusting headband is both secure and comfortable - great for long listening sessions

Tech Specs

  • Type: Wired
  • Open/Closed: Closed
  • Fit Style: Circumaural (Around the Ear)
  • Driver Size: 50mm
  • Noise Attenuation: Passive Noise Isolation
  • Frequency Response: 10kHz-25kHz
  • Impedance: 32 ohms
  • Connectivity: 1/8" plug, 1/4" adapter
  • Cable Type: Straight
  • Cable Length: 8.25 ft.
  • Color: Black
  • Weight: 0.67 lbs.
  • Manufacturer Part Number: SASR950

Don't Overlook These Cans. Super Comfort & Amazing Clarity at a Great Price Point
Pros: Lightweight materials, flat & adjustable headband, and plush ear piece cushioning make these headphones very comfortable. I wear a behind-the-ear hearing aid in my left ear, and these cans offer plenty of room and a favorable shape for my hearing aid to fit inside and to pick up the sound very well. Bass is very clear and present but not overpowering. All other frequencies are clearly defined and the response is relatively flat helping me hear acoustic detail in my tracks that I had never heard before, even with my worn-down Sennheiser HD 280 Pro headphones that cost me little more jiggle. The 2.5 meter cord is plenty long for me to move around to different parts of my studio with ease.

Cons: Styling cues are modest and perhaps a little clunky. The plush cushioning tends to pick up pet/head hairs and little bits over a short time. The light-weight plastic construction, while lending greatly to comfort for long recording/mixing sessions, decreases the perception of build quality while handling them. Both the light-weight plastic and the plush are features that lend to comfort at the expense of aesthetics. It's a willing trade-off for me as these are not primarily meant to be some sort of fashion statement. So I only took of a 1/2 star for aesthetics.

Overall, superb sound quality & comfort for the money! I would highly recommend them to the recording artist/engineer who is on a budget! : )
